Anton Rudjuk Athlete Profile
Personal
-
Parents are Valery and Olga
-
Born in Moscow, Russia
-
Favorite tennis player is Thomas Muster
-
Has one sister named Alina
Before BYU
-
Started playing tennis seven years ago
-
Number two in Pacific Northwest under 18 division
-
No. 1 in British Columbia Section under 18 division.

1999-2000 | Freshman Year
-
In singles, Rudjuk went 13-13 on the season
-
In doubles he teamed with David White, Jeff Olsen, Carlos Lozano and Michael Faust to compile a 7-7 record
2000-2001 | Sophomore Year
-
Ranked No. 27 in Region 7 in fall rankings
-
Went 2-2 in doubles with Michael Gysens
-
Was 2-2 in fall tournaments
-
Went 8-1 in singles mostly at the No. 3 spot
-
Went 7-7 in doubles at the two and three spots
2001-2002 | Junior Year
-
Played in semifinals at BYU Invitational, losing to teammate Vilms
-
Played doubles with Jeremy Price and won consolation doubles at BYU Invitational
-
Primarily played singles for the team this season at the four and five spots
-
Posted an even 12-12 record in singles play
